MoI has warned public not to open links from unknown sources

The Ministry of Interior (MoI) has cautioned the public against clicking on links or replying to messages from unidentified sources, while emphasizing the need of avoiding cybercrime dangers.

In an alert, the MoI stated, "We advise avoiding opening links and not responding to messages from unknown sources to be safe from the risks of cybercrimes."

The MoI has advised the public to exercise caution in order to avoid falling victim to phishing attempts, which employ emails or messaging platforms to deceive people into opening attachments that contain dangerous files or clicking on links.

Phishing, a type of fraud, involves using email or other communication channels to pose as a trustworthy organization or individual in order to collect sensitive information. It frequently leads people to provide personal information on a phony website that looks and feels exactly like the real one.

The ministry has stressed the value of data privacy and advised against sharing personal information online.
